Beaumaris Road and The Circle are accommodation-based supported housing schemes located in Swindon providing supported accommodation for young parents aged between 16 – 25 years.

The accommodation consists of 12 self-contained, two bedroom flats which are:

  • Carpeted
  • Contain white goods, such as a washing machine, cooker and fridge.

The service also features a large communal facility where we hold regular baby and toddler groups as well as communal gardens for customers.

Referrals are made exclusively via Swindon Borough Council and the criteria is as follows:

  • Single pregnant females (not less than 29 weeks)
  • Single parents with no more than 2 children under the age of 5
  • Couples – 1 child only under age of 5
  • Vulnerable, homeless, threatened with homelessness.

Customers are expected to demonstrate a willingness to engage with a personal programme focussing on education, training, employment & life skills and abide by the rules of their tenancy agreement.

Depending on need, we provide a range of housing related support in order that they gain the independent living skills needed to move on to their own independent home including:

  • Setting up and maintaining a home and/or tenancy
  • Developing domestic, parenting, life, social skills and behaviour management
  • Support in managing finances and benefit claims
  • Access to other services and local community organisations
  • Emotional support and advice
  • Health & wellbeing
  • Customers will receive at least one, 1 hour key work session per week.
